在Java中,方法是一段可重用的代碼塊,用于執行特定的任務。方法定義了方法的名稱、參數和返回值類型,以及方法體中要執行的代碼。
下面是一個示例,展示了如何定義和使用一個簡單的Java方法:
public class MyClass {
// 定義一個方法,該方法不接受參數并且沒有返回值
public void sayHello() {
System.out.println("Hello!");
}
// 定義一個方法,該方法接受兩個整數參數并返回它們的和
public int addNumbers(int a, int b) {
int sum = a + b;
return sum;
}
public static void main(String[] args) {
MyClass myObj = new MyClass();
myObj.sayHello(); // 調用sayHello()方法,輸出 "Hello!"
int result = myObj.addNumbers(5, 3); // 調用addNumbers()方法,傳入參數并接收返回值
System.out.println("Sum: " + result); // 輸出 "Sum: 8"
}
}
在上面的示例中,我們定義了一個名為sayHello()
的方法,它不接受任何參數并且沒有返回值。方法體中的代碼用于輸出"Hello!"。
我們還定義了一個名為addNumbers()
的方法,它接受兩個整數參數a
和b
,并返回它們的和。方法體中的代碼用于計算并返回兩個參數的和。
在main()
方法中,我們創建了一個MyClass
對象myObj
,然后通過對象調用sayHello()
方法和addNumbers()
方法。addNumbers()
方法接收參數5
和3
,并將返回值存儲在result
變量中,最后輸出result
的值。
這就是Java方法的基本定義和使用。你可以根據需要定義自己的方法,并在程序中調用它們來執行特定的任務。